South Carolina running back Tavien Feaster played his last college football contest in the team's 38-3 loss to No. 3 Clemson.

Feaster has nothing but love for his former teammates at Clemson and even exchanged jerseys with running back Travis Etienne during postgame handshakes.

"It's my guy (Etienne). We gonna catch up after the season that is what really was said. I am going to pull for them (Clemson) regardless. I spent three years there. I want to see those guys, my teammates do well. Nothing bad, all love for them."
